[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/PILC_THET8 PILC_THET8] Essential inner membrane component of the type IV pilus (T4P) that plays a role in surface and host cell adhesion, colonization, biofilm maturation, virulence, and twitching, a form of surface-associated motility facilitated by cycles of extension, adhesion, and retraction of T4P fibers. Controls both pilus assembly and disassembly and plays an important role in PilB localization to the complex and ATPase activity.[UniProtKB:P22609]
